The workshop was conducted to empower the candidates who are > >>> called > >>> for the interview scheduled in the month of January-2014. > >>> > >>> Session Objective: > >>> > >>> This empowering workshop intended to equip the participants with the > >>> essential skills required for cracking the interview. In majority of > >>> cases > >>> it is observed that interview panel does not consist of a member who is > >>> aware about the assistive technology or the abilities of the visually > >>> impaired person. So in this scenario it becomes imperative on part of > >>> the > >>> interview candidate to demonstrate and inform the interview board about > >>> strengths of a visually impaired person. The area that shall be > >>> concentrated > >>> was probable questions based on past experiences, effective entry and > >>> exit > >>> skills, body language and transmission of strong areas of the > >>> participant > >>> during the interview. > >>> > >>> Session Highlights: > >>> > >>> The workshop was facilitated by Dr. Ashwini Kumar Agarwal and Mr. > >>> > >>> Dipendra Manocha.
